It would be a much better user experience if chats with more than one model could expand to take up the full width.
With 2-3 models the width of each model's response is compacted to fit multiple. With 4+ models it has to scroll. However, it would be better to increase the width of these responses to take up the available space. Or, at least have the option to do so. Perhaps a customizable width, allowing you to scroll if you want would be best. So, you could use the full width to fit all 4 side by side, or have each one be full size individually and scroll through them.
